scope:
General
1. The Rules relating to redundant propulsion and steering systems apply to ships, which are classified by Germanischer Lloyd (GL) and are to receive the notation RP1 x%, RP2 x% or RP3 x% affixed to the character of classification.
The Rules apply in addition to the Society's Rules for Classification and Construction, in particular
- Chapter 1, Hull structures
- Chapter 2, Machinery installations
- Chapter 3, Electrical installations
- Chapter 4, Automation
2. The Rules for redundant propulsion and steering systems stipulate the level of redundancy for the propulsion and steering systems. It is characterised by the appropriate notation to be affixed to the character of classification.
3. The Rules are based on the single-failure concept.
